What Is HR Management Software?
HR management software is a digital solution that helps businesses manage core HR activities such as employee data, payroll processing, attendance tracking, leave management, and compliance. Modern HRMS software for businesses integrates multiple HR processes into one centralized system, reducing manual effort and improving accuracy.

Step 2: Look for Essential HR Management Features
A reliable HR management software should include:
Centralized employee records, role-based access, and easy data management.
Automated salary calculation, deductions, tax support, and payslip generation to minimize payroll errors.
Attendance & Leave Tracking
Accurate time tracking, leave approvals, and real-time attendance visibility.
Employee Self-Service (ESS)
Allows employees to access payslips, attendance, leave balance, and personal details independently.
